Circle's NYSE Debut
Circle's debut on the New York Stock Exchange on June 5 marked an important event for the stablecoin issuer. The company's stock surged over fivefold in a short time, climbing from $69 to over $260. This underscores the company's growing influence in the financial market.

Market Analysis and USDC Stability
USDC remains stable at $1.00, with a market cap of $62.26 billion. Despite a 47.31% drop in its 24-hour trading volume, USDC continues to secure a strong presence in digital finance, reflecting the growing demand for stablecoin solutions in volatile markets.
